A plant-based, oral delivery of insulin regulates blood sugar levels similar to natural insulin
A new, affordable method of insulin delivery developed by Henry Daniell of the School of Dental Medicine lowers the risk of hypoglycemia when compared to current diabetes treatments.
Penn Dental Medicine collaboration identifies new bacterial species involved in tooth decay
A large study in children reveals Selenomonas sputigena as a key partner of Streptococcus in cavity formation.

Microbes that cause cavities can form superorganisms able to ‘crawl’ and spread on teeth
These multicellular, cross-kingdom assemblages were more resistant to antimicrobials and removal and caused more extensive tooth decay than their single-species equivalents, according to research led by School of Dental Medicine scientists.
